From the Nieuwe Maas side in Katendrecht, you have a nice view of Wilhelminapier (Kop van Zuid) with its beautiful skyline. The park provides wonderful coolness on hot days in this city.
Rotterdam is steadily building a colourful skyline both on the city centre side along the Boompjes and here around the Kop van Zuid.
This makes Rotterdammers proud because reconstruction has continued with renewal, innovation and a modern look. Old residential and industrial areas are being put to good use again.
Notable buildings are: Montevideo, Maastoren, New Orleans, Theater LantarenVenster, De Rotterdam, Boston and Seattle.
In the background flaunts the New Luxor, the Maastoren, the Gerechtsgebouw and InHolland, among others.
Work is currently underway to expand destinations on the water in the Rijnhaven! The former pilot boat Castor was already a great addition but it gets even better. New is the Floating Office.
